Форум программистов, компьютерный форум CyberForum.ru

почему изменяется и первый экземпляр класса -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Как задать звук в консоли http://www.cyberforum.ru/cpp-beginners/thread360765.html
Не как не могу найти функцию которая воспроизводить стандартный звук из колонок
C++ определение нахождения точки Есть окружность с радиусом R центром О. Есть также точка А. Программа должна определять нахождение точки и если она в окружности то выводится соответсвующие сообщение. http://www.cyberforum.ru/cpp-beginners/thread360763.html
C++ Определить номера букв русского алфавита
Добрый день. Суть вопроса: нужно для заданной строки определить номера букв русского алфавита. Немного погуглив, узнал, что это можно сделать через ASCII код. Но как именно не разобрался, т.к. знания в си++ еще невысокие. Подскажите пожалуйста, как это можно осуществить.
reinterpret_cast помогите разобраться C++
#include <iostream> #include <conio.h> using namespace std; int schet_not_null(int *matrix, int i_matrix, int j_matrix, int *not_null) { int schet = 0; /*for (int i = 0; i < j_matrix; i++) not_null = 1; for (int i = 0; i < i_matrix; i++) { for (int j = 0; j < j_matrix; j++) {
C++ Функции. http://www.cyberforum.ru/cpp-beginners/thread360703.html
Подскажите, пожалуйста. Задание: В результате вызова функции mangle("Rad vas videt") возвращает символ R или указатель на строку "Dobro pogalovat", в зависимости от того, присваиваете ли вы возвращаемое значение переменной типа char или переменной типа char*;
C++ Создание Массива Объектов класса Здравствуйте, такая вот проблемка возникла: нужно создать массив B объектов класса TGoods. И далее по определенному значению year найти все объекты из массива у которых year точно такой же + вывести на экран name совпавших year. вроде все правильно сделал. компилируется все хорошо. но когда начинаю заполнять массив объектов вываливается ошибка. подскажите пожалуйста в чем дело код... подробнее

Показать сообщение отдельно
Adept88
1 / 1 / 0
Регистрация: 13.09.2011
Сообщений: 19
05.10.2011, 11:49  [ТС]     почему изменяется и первый экземпляр класса
Спасибо всем, разобрался

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
#include <iostream>
using namespace std;
 
class word
{
    public:
        void add(char *x) { m = new char(strlen(x)-1); strcpy (m, x);}
        char* get() { return m;}
    private:
        char *m;
};
 
 
int main()
{
    word a, b;
    char x[20];
    cout<<"Введите слово1: ";
    cin>>x;
    a.add(x);
    cout<<"Введите слово2: ";
    cin>>x;
    b.add(x);
    cout<<a.get()<<" "<<b.get();
    system("pause");
    return 0;
}
 
Текущее время: 04:25.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ru